logistic-regression-from-scratch

Designing a simple logistic regression algorithm from scratch, without the use of external ML libraries.
(current version: 0.1)

Author: Siddharth Yadav (syntax-surgeon)

main.ipynb

  • Contains version-0.1 of the main program which tries to implement a logistic regression algorithm
  • The core of the algorithm is based on an intuitive implementation of basic gradient descent combined with a non-linear function (sigmoid)
  • The current version of the codebase is functional, however, future versions may be OOP-based
  • Simple plotting functionality is included to visualize the results of the training
